#18880f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18880f is composed of 9.4% red, 53.3%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 89%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 115.5 degrees, a saturation of 80.1% and a lightness of 29.6%. #18880f color hex could be obtained by blending #30ff1e with #001100.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

#18880f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#18880f has RGB values of R:24, G:136,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0, Y:0.89,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 1607695.
